Dissecting the Myth of Italy

It is true that Italy has an incredible history and a vibrant culture. However, there are some aspects of the Italian experience that don’t quite live up to the hype. For example, food may be delicious, but it is often overpriced and the portions are small. Transportation can also be a challenge; the public transport system is often unreliable and congested. Finally, there is the language barrier – many locals speak only Italian, making it difficult for tourists to communicate.

In short, the myth of Italy is that of a romantic, picturesque destination – but the reality is more complicated. It is true that there are many wonderful things to experience in Italy, but it is important to keep an open mind and be prepared for some challenges.

A Skeptical Look at the Italian Experience

The tourist experience in Italy can be hit-or-miss. While many of the iconic attractions, such as the Colosseum or the Leaning Tower of Pisa, are truly amazing, there are some areas that are overpriced and underwhelming. The same can be said of some of the more touristy restaurants and cafes – they may be beautiful, but the quality of the food can be lacking.

Another thing to consider is that some areas of Italy can be dangerous. Pickpocketing is common in crowded areas, and it is important to be vigilant and aware at all times. Additionally, some areas are prone to violent crime, so it is best to avoid them altogether if possible.
